Whispers of Betrayal: The Lingchuan Reckoning
The sun dipped low over Lingchuan, casting long shadows that danced with the flickering flames of the town's streetlamps. The air was thick with the scent of blooming jasmine and the distant hum of evening chatter. But tonight, the tranquility of the town was shattered by a single, chilling event.
The murder of Master Li, the revered head of the Li family, had sent shockwaves through the community. Master Li, known for his wisdom and benevolence, had been found lifeless in his own study, a knife embedded in his chest. The townsfolk were in a state of shock and disbelief. Whispers of betrayal and intrigue filled the air as the police began their investigation.
Detective Chen, a seasoned investigator, arrived at the crime scene. The study was a mess, with papers scattered across the floor and the desk overturned. The window was slightly ajar, suggesting a struggle had occurred. Chen's eyes scanned the room, noting every detail.
"This doesn't make sense," Chen murmured to himself, examining the knife. It was an ancient, ornate blade, unlike anything he had seen before. The handle was carved with intricate patterns that seemed to tell a story of its own.
Chen's attention was drawn to a portrait of Master Li's great-grandfather on the wall. The portrait had been tampered with, a single eye socket now empty, the lid removed as if something had been hidden there. His mind raced as he pieced together the puzzle.
He called for his partner, Detective Wang, who had been following up on leads in the Li family. Wang entered the room, his face a mask of concern.
"Chen, what do you think?" Wang asked, his voice barely above a whisper.
"I think someone is covering their tracks," Chen replied, his eyes narrowing. "The portrait is a clue. I need to look into the Li family's history."
As Chen delved deeper into the Li family's past, he uncovered a hidden enmity that had been buried for generations. The Li family had once been the most powerful in Lingchuan, but they had fallen from grace, their wealth and influence lost to time. The current head of the family, Master Li, had been striving to restore their legacy, but in doing so, had become a target for those who still harbored resentment.
Chen's investigation led him to an old, abandoned mansion on the outskirts of town. The mansion was said to be haunted, but Chen's determination to uncover the truth drove him forward. Inside, he found a hidden room filled with ancient artifacts and a cryptic map.
The map led him to a cave deep within the mountains surrounding Lingchuan. Chen and Wang ventured into the cave, their flashlights cutting through the darkness. The air was cool and damp, and the sound of dripping water echoed through the cavern. As they pressed deeper into the cave, they stumbled upon a hidden chamber.
Inside the chamber was a man, bound and gagged. His eyes met Chen's, filled with fear and desperation. "Help me," he whispered.
The man was an old friend of Master Li, someone who had once been close to the family. Chen quickly freed him, and the man revealed that he had been framed for the murder. He explained that the real killer was a member of the Li family, someone who had been working to sabotage Master Li's efforts to restore their legacy.
Chen and Wang confronted the true culprit, a young man who had been driven by greed and jealousy. The young man admitted to the murder but claimed he had acted alone. Chen wasn't convinced, and his investigation continued.
As Chen delved further, he uncovered a web of deceit that went beyond the Li family. He discovered that the old mansion and the cave were connected to a secret society that had been manipulating events in Lingchuan for centuries. The society had been using the Li family as a pawn to further their own agenda.
The climax of the investigation came when Chen and Wang confronted the head of the secret society. The head, a powerful and cunning man, revealed his true intentions. He had been using the Li family to divide and conquer the town, all in the name of his own power.
With the truth finally revealed, Chen and Wang were able to bring the culprits to justice. The Li family was cleared of all charges, and the secret society was disbanded. The town of Lingchuan could finally begin to heal from the wounds of betrayal and intrigue.
As the sun rose over Lingchuan the next morning, the town seemed to breathe a collective sigh of relief. The shadows of the past had been cast away, and the people of Lingchuan could look to the future with hope.
Detective Chen stood on the rooftop of the police station, watching the town awaken. He knew that the battle against corruption and deceit was far from over, but he also knew that with every victory, the world became a little brighter.
The Lingchuan Mystery had been unraveled, but the whispers of betrayal would continue to echo through the town for years to come.
